We assign a fundamental rating of 5 out of 10 to PBI. PBI was compared to 82 industry peers in the Commercial Services & Supplies industry. PBI has a medium profitability rating, but doesn't score so well on its financial health evaluation. PBI has a bad growth rate and is valued cheaply. PBI also has an excellent dividend rating.

2.2 Solvency

PBI has an Altman-Z score of 2.15. This is not the best score and indicates that PBI is in the grey zone with still only limited risk for bankruptcy at the moment.
The Altman-Z score of PBI (2.15) is comparable to the rest of the industry.
PBI has a debt to FCF ratio of 9.24. This is a negative value and a sign of low solvency as PBI would need 9.24 years to pay back of all of its debts.
The Debt to FCF ratio of PBI (9.24) is better than 62.20% of its industry peers.

2.3 Liquidity

PBI has a Current Ratio of 0.81. This is a bad value and indicates that PBI is not financially healthy enough and could expect problems in meeting its short term obligations.
PBI has a worse Current ratio (0.81) than 80.49% of its industry peers.
PBI has a Quick Ratio of 0.81. This is a bad value and indicates that PBI is not financially healthy enough and could expect problems in meeting its short term obligations.
With a Quick ratio value of 0.76, PBI is not doing good in the industry: 78.05% of the companies in the same industry are doing better.
